Livre d'Ézéchiel 19


font
JERUSALEMKING JAMES BIBLE
1 Et toi, prononce une complainte sur les princes d'Israël.1 Moreover take thou up a lamentation for the princes of Israel,
2 Tu diras: Qu'était ta mère? Une lionne parmi des lions; couchée parmi les lionceaux, ellenourrissait ses petits.2 And say, What is thy mother? A lioness: she lay down among lions, she nourished her whelps among young lions.
3 Elle éleva un de ses petits, il devint un jeune lion, il apprit à déchirer sa proie, il dévora deshommes.3 And she brought up one of her whelps: it became a young lion, and it learned to catch the prey; it devoured men.
4 Les nations en entendirent parler, il fut pris dans leur fosse; on l'emmena avec des crocs au paysd'Egypte.4 The nations also heard of him; he was taken in their pit, and they brought him with chains unto the land of Egypt.
5 Elle vit que son attente était déçue, déçue son espérance. Elle prit un autre de ses petits, en fit unjeune lion.5 Now when she saw that she had waited, and her hope was lost, then she took another of her whelps, and made him a young lion.
6 Il rôda parmi les lions, il devint un jeune lion; il apprit à déchirer sa proie, il dévora des hommes.6 And he went up and down among the lions, he became a young lion, and learned to catch the prey, and devoured men.
7 Il démolit leurs palais, il détruisit leurs villes; le pays et ses habitants furent consternés au bruit deson rugissement.7 And he knew their desolate palaces, and he laid waste their cities; and the land was desolate, and the fulness thereof, by the noise of his roaring.
8 On dressa contre lui les nations, les provinces environnantes; elles étendirent sur lui leur filet, ilfut pris dans leur fosse.8 Then the nations set against him on every side from the provinces, and spread their net over him: he was taken in their pit.
9 Avec des crocs ils le mirent en cage, ils le menèrent au roi de Babylone, ils le menèrent dans deslieux escarpés, pour qu'on n'entendît plus sa voix sur les montagnes d'Israël.9 And they put him in ward in chains, and brought him to the king of Babylon: they brought him into holds, that his voice should no more be heard upon the mountains of Israel.
10 Ta mère était semblable à une vigne, plantée au bord de l'eau. Elle était féconde et feuillue, grâceà l'abondance de l'eau.10 Thy mother is like a vine in thy blood, planted by the waters: she was fruitful and full of branches by reason of many waters.
11 Elle eut des ceps puissants qui devinrent des sceptres royaux; sa taille s'éleva jusqu'au milieu desnuages; on l'admira pour sa hauteur et la quantité de ses branches.11 And she had strong rods for the sceptres of them that bare rule, and her stature was exalted among the thick branches, and she appeared in her height with the multitude of her branches.
12 Mais elle a été arrachée avec fureur et jetée à terre; le vent d'est a desséché son fruit, elle a étébrisée, son cep puissant a séché, le feu l'a dévoré.12 But she was plucked up in fury, she was cast down to the ground, and the east wind dried up her fruit: her strong rods were broken and withered; the fire consumed them.
13 La voici plantée au désert, au pays sec et aride,13 And now she is planted in the wilderness, in a dry and thirsty ground.
14 et le feu est sorti de son cep, il a dévoré ses tiges et son fruit. Elle n'aura plus son sceptrepuissant, son sceptre royal. C'est une complainte; elle servit de complainte.14 And fire is gone out of a rod of her branches, which hath devoured her fruit, so that she hath no strong rod to be a sceptre to rule. This is a lamentation, and shall be for a lamentation.
